  • In October 2023, Micro Medical Devices (MMD), Inc. collaborated with Device Technologies to distribute the Symani system across the Philippines, Hong Kong, Singapore, Thailand, Vietnam, Malaysia, Indonesia, Macau, and New Zealand
  • In October 2022, a segment of Zeiss Group, the parent company of Carl Zeiss Meditech AG, announced a new microsite featuring nine researchers and 24 areas of study, celebrating breakthroughs achieved by Zeiss instruments
  • In July 2022, Micro Medical Devices (MMD), Inc. secured USD 75 million to expand the commercialization of its Symani microsurgery system in the U.S
  • In October 2021, Leica Microsystems launched a new generation of its M320 dental microscope, offering ultra-high-resolution imaging with an integrated camera, aimed at enhancing dental treatment outcomes and increasing dentist comfort
  • In September 2020, True Digital Surgery and Aesculap, Inc. announced that the Aesculap Aeos Robotic Digital Microscope was available in the U.S., enabling surgeons to execute high-precision movements in surgeries such as neurosurgery, spine, and ear, nose, and throat procedures
